1 deep
B adj1 ( vertically) [hole, ditch, water, wound, wrinkle, breath, sigh, curtsey, armchair] profond ; [mud, snow, carpet] épais/épaisse ; [container, drawer, saucepan, grass] haut ; deep roots Bot racines fpl profondes ; fig bases fpl ; deep cleansing Cosmet nettoyage en profondeur ; a deep-pile carpet une moquette de haute laine ; how deep is the river/wound? quelle est la profondeur de la rivière/blessure? ; the lake is 13 m deep le lac a 13 m de profondeur ; a hole 5 cm deep, a 5 cm deep hole un trou de 5 cm ; the floor was 10 cm deep in water le sol se trouvait sous 10 cm d'eau ; the sound/spring came from a source deep in the earth le son/la fontaine provenait des profondeurs de la terre ;2 ( horizontally) [border, band, strip] large ; [shelf, drawer, cupboard, alcove, stage] profond ; a shelf 30 cm deep une étagère de 30 cm de profondeur ; people were standing six deep les gens étaient debout sur six rangées ; cars were parked three deep les voitures étaient garées sur trois files ;3 fig ( intense) [admiration, concern, depression, dismay, love, faith, impression, sorrow] profond ; [interest, regret, shame] profond, grand ; [desire, need, pleasure] grand ; [difficulty, trouble] gros/grosse ; Physiol [coma, sleep] profond ; my deepest sympathy parfois hum toutes mes condoléances ;4 ( impenetrable) [darkness, forest, jungle, mystery] profond ; [secret] grand ; [person] réservé ; they live in deepest Wales hum ils habitent au fin fond du pays de Galles ; you're a deep one ○ ! tu caches bien ton jeu ○ ! ;5 ( intellectually profound) [idea, insight, meaning, truth, book, thinker] profond ; [knowledge, discussion] approfondi ; [thought] ( concentrated) profond ; ( intimate) intime ; at a deeper level plus en profondeur ;8 (involved, absorbed) to be deep in être absorbé dans [thought, entertainment] ; être plongé dans [book, conversation, work] ; to be deep in debt être endetté jusqu'au cou ;9 [shot, serve] en profondeur.C adv1 ( a long way down) [dig, bury, cut] profondément ; he thrust his hands deep into his pockets/the snow il a enfoncé ses mains dans ses poches/la neige ; she dived deep into the lake elle a plongé dans les profondeurs du lac ; he plunged the knife deep into her body il lui a planté le couteau dans le corps ; deep in the cellars tout au fond des caves ; deep beneath the sea/the earth's surface à une grande profondeur sous la mer/la surface de la terre ; to sink/dig deeper s'enfoncer/creuser plus profondément ; to dig deeper into an affair fig creuser (plus loin) une affaire ; to sink deeper into debt fig s'endetter davantage ; he drank deep of the wine littér il a bu une large rasade de vin ;2 ( a long way in) deep in ou into au cœur de ; deep in the forest, all was still au cœur de la forêt, le silence régnait ; to go deep into the woods s'enfoncer au cœur des bois ; deep in the heart of the maquis/of Texas au cœur du maquis/du Texas ; deep in space loin dans l'espace ; deep in my heart tout au fond de mon cœur ; to be deep in thought/discussion être plongé dans ses pensées/dans une discussion ; to work/talk deep into the night travailler/causer jusque tard dans la nuit ; he gazed deep into my eyes littér il s'est noyé dans mon regard ;3 fig (emotionally, in psyche) deep down ou inside dans mon/ton etc for intérieur ; deep down she was frightened dans son for intérieur elle avait peur ; deep down she's a nice woman elle a un bon fond ; to go deep [faith, emotion, loyalty, instinct] être profond ; his problems go deeper than that ses problèmes sont bien plus graves que cela ; to run deep [belief, feeling, prejudice] être bien enraciné ;4 Sport [hit, kick, serve] en profondeur.to be in deep ○ y être jusqu'au cou ○ ; to be in deep water être dans de beaux draps ○. -
